As the Learning and Development Manager, you will:
- Develop and implement a learning strategy and framework that is aligned with the organisation’s objectives
- Stay abreast of the latest developments in learning trends, changes in learning theory, developments in learning technologies and different training techniques including e-learning, coaching, mentoring, classroom training and workshops
- Define and communicate the organisation’s annual education priorities, allowing flexibility to respond to emerging risks and training needs.
- Use your change management skills to work collaboratively with the business to drive outcomes and engagement
- Collaborate with key stakeholders and lead the development of a sustainable role-based training matrix identifying mandatory and optional training, ensuring these at a minimum, meet the requirements of the Aged Care Quality Standards
- Manage the e-learning platform, supervising: onboarding of new staff, allocation of training modules (as per the training matrix), recording of live training sessions and uploading of new training modules
- Manage the team of educators across the employee lifecycle including recruitment, orientation, appraisals, performance, succession, retention, work distribution and review of achievements against pre-set targets
- Prepare monthly and quarterly reports that identify mandatory completion rates and insights to enable targeted strategies to improve performance

To be successful you will need:
- At least three years’ experience in an education leadership role
- Bachelor of Nursing or equivalent with current AHPRA registration
- An understanding of the Aged Care Quality Standards
- Cert IV in Assessment and Workplace Training
- Proven track record of designing and implementing successful training programs
- Strong project management skills, capable of coordinating multiple learning initiatives simultaneously
- In-depth knowledge of learning theories, instructional design principles, and adult learning methodologies
- Proficient in using learning management systems (LMS) and other e-learning platforms to deliver and track training programs
- Excellent communication and presentation skills, able to deliver engaging and impactful training sessions to diverse audiences
- Excellent leadership skills, with the ability to inspire and motivate team members
- Data-driven mindset, using analytics and metrics to measure the effectiveness of training programs and identify areas for improvement
- Adaptable and innovative, able to continuously update and evolve learning strategies to meet the changing needs of the organisation
- Exceptional interpersonal skills, fostering positive relationships with stakeholders and collaborating effectively across departments
- Bachelor’s degree in Organisational Development, Education, or a related field (desirable)
- Previous experience working in an Aged Care environment (desirable)
- Current Australian Drivers Licence and your own vehicle
- National Police Clearance or willingness to obtain (myHomecare can organise this at no cost to you)
- The right to work in Australia
